“Omnishambles” – word of the year by Oxford English Dictionary

"Omnishambles" has been named word of the year by the Oxford English Dictionary.

The meaning of the word ‘Omnishambles’ is – a situation which is shambolic from every possible angle.

The word was coined in 2009 by the writers of BBC political satire The Thick of It.
